摘 要:研究对黄芩苷微粉添加剂进行急性毒性试验、生理生化、免疫指标和亚慢性毒性试验,评价黄芩苷微粉添加剂的安全性。结果表明:黄芩苷微粉添加剂经口半数致死量(LD50)为4.41 g/kg,LD50的95%可信限为3.21~6.04 g/kg。给药14 d后家兔血液中白细胞计数(WBC)和红细胞总数(RBC)下降,而肌酐(CRE)、尿素氮(BUN)、谷草转氨酶(AST)、谷丙转氨酶(ALT)有升高趋势,但差异不显著(P<0.05)。和对照组相比,给药第7 d和第14 d,中剂量组家兔血清免疫球蛋白A(IgA)、免疫球蛋白G(IgG)含量显著提高(P<0.05)。组织学结果表明,低剂量和中剂量组肝脏和肾脏组织结构清晰,高剂量组为肝索排列紊乱,肝窦、肾小球有少量出血。结果提示,常规剂量添加黄芩苷微粉添加剂安全性好,且能够提高动物机体免疫力,具有替代抗生素的潜在价值,具有较好的应用前景。Using the baicalin micro-powder,the acute toxicity test and chronic toxicity test were to evaluate the clinical safety of baicalin micropowder.The results showed that the acute toxicity test indicated that the LD50 of baicalin micropowder was 4.41 g/kg after oral administration of its suspension and 95%confidence interval was 3.21~6.04 g/kg.Hematology analysis showed that WBC and RBC count of rabbits decreased and CRE,BUN,AST of rabbits and ALT had elevated trend during 14 d after oral administration,but had no significant different(P>0.05).The contents of IgA,IgG of rabbits in medium-dose groups were significantly increased on 7 d and 14 d(P<0.05).There was no visible pathological changes on the liver,kidney histology.According to pathological observation the structure of liver and kidney were clear in low and middle dose group,but disorganized hepatic cell cords was found in the liver and hemorrhage between glomerulo and hepatic sinusoids in high dose group.In summary,the baicalin micro-powder could be considered as a safe in clinical treatment,and it can significantly improve the immunity.Baicalin has the potential to replace feeding antibiotics and has a good application prospect and promotion value.
